Description
Services addressed here are those required for broadcast operation support services for the American Forces Network Broadcast Center’s (AFN-BC) suite of 24/7 television channels.
1. The services require management and technical personnel to provide daily TV Traffic and Programming Products to support television broadcast operations from the AFN-BC.
2. Critical performance requirements include sensitive media handling, speed, accuracy and performance that adhere to DoD and broadcast industry standards.
3. The broadcast industry sells the service by billing hourly rates for the services of television broadcast managers and producers. The PWS is written to conform to industry expectations
